History
As one of the oldest emergency medicine programs in the country, they continue to challenge their residents with an emphasis on critical care, EMS/Life Flight® and emergency point-of-care ultrasound.
Their goal is to produce an extremely well-rounded emergency physician who can work and adapt to any emergency environment.

Curriculum
PGY1
- EM Orientation - 1 month
- Pediatric Acute Care - 1 month
- Pediatric Acute Care - 1 month
- Pediatric Intensive Care - 1 month
- Cardiology - 1 month
- Anesthesia - 1 month
- Ultrasound / EMS - 1 month
- Critical Care Medicine - 2 months
- Obstetrics 1 month
PGY2
- EM - 7 months
- Cardiology - 1 month
- Critical Care Medicine - 1 month
- Jeopardy / Research - 1 month
- Pediatric Acute Care - 1 month
- Trauma - 1 month
PGY3
- EM - 8 months
- EM / Research - 1 month
- EM Community Practice - 1 month
- Electives - 2 months
